IConverterSession::SetCharSet
Gilt für: Outlook 2013 | Outlook 2016
Gibt einen optionalen Zeichensatz an, den der MAPI-in-MIME-Konverter beim Konvertieren einer MAPI-Nachricht in einen MIME-Stream verwendet.
HRESULT SetCharset(
BOOL fApply,
HCHARSET hcharset,
CSETAPPLYTYPE csetapplytype);
Parameter
fApply
[in] Gibt an, ob ein bestimmter Zeichensatz für die Konvertierung verwendet werden soll. Legen Sie diesen Parameter auf true fest, um den Zeichensatz in nachfolgenden Konvertierungen anzuwenden. Legen Sie diesen Parameter auf false fest, wenn Sie keinen bestimmten Zeichensatz mehr anwenden und für nachfolgende Nachrichten zu den Standardwerten zurückkehren möchten.
hcharset
[in] Ein Handle für einen Zeichensatz, wie in mimeole.h von Windows Mail definiert. Geben Sie NULL an, um anzugeben, dass Kein bestimmter Zeichensatz angewendet werden soll. Verwenden Sie für Nicht-NULL-Werte eine Funktion wie MimeOleGetCodePageCharset , um ein Handle für den Zeichensatz abzurufen.
csetapplytype
[in] Gibt an, wie ein Zeichensatz angewendet wird, um eine Nachricht zu konvertieren, wie in mimeole.h von Windows Mail definiert.
Rückgabewert
S_OK
Der Funktionsaufruf ist erfolgreich.
MFCMAPI-Referenz
Einen MFCMAP-Beispielcode finden Sie in der folgenden Tabelle.
Datei | Funktion | Kommentar |
---|---|---|
MapiMime.cpp |
ImportEMLToIMessage |
MFCMAPI verwendet MimeToMAPI, um eine EML-Datei in eine MAPI-Nachricht zu konvertieren. |
MapiMime.cpp |
ExportIMessageToEML |
MFCMAPI verwendet MAPIToMIMEStm, um eine MAPI-Nachricht in eine EML-Datei zu konvertieren. |
Siehe auch
IConverterSession::MAPIToMIMEStm
IConverterSession::SetEncoding